Attached five-bay gable-fronted building attached to former convent, built c. 1880, having three-bay gable, single-bay two-storey lean-to extension to west elevation and single-bay single-storey extension to east elevation. Later used as nursing home, now disused. Pitched slate roof having rendered chimneystacks, cast-iron rainwater goods, carved limestone cross finial to gable apexes and limestone copings to gables. Lined-and-ruled painted rendered walls with quatrefoil recessed panels to east and west gables and cast-iron fire escape to east gable. Pointed arch window openings to first floor of north and south elevations, and square-headed window openings to ground floor, having twelve-over-twelve pane timber sliding sash windows, all having painted sills. Pointed arch window openings to west gable, first floor having fixed mullioned timber window with traceried tops to four-over-ten pane lights, flanked by eight-over-twelve pane timber sliding sash windows with traceried tops, all having painted sills, and ground floor having square-headed window opening flanked by pointed arch openings, all having six-over-six pane timber sliding sash windows with painted sills, pointed windows having traceried top lifts. Tudor-arch window openings to first floor of east gable, having sixteen-over-sixteen pane timber sliding sash windows with painted sills. Square-headed window openings to two-storey link part, having replacement timber windows. Square-headed door opening to east gable, having half-glazed timber battened door. Heating pipes to interior ceiling, encased in timber panelling and having some corbelling. Timber panelled shutters to internal window surrounds.
